摘要
This study experimentally demonstrates a large measurement range curvature sensor based on a Mach-Zehnder interferometer (MZI) in a triple-ring-core fiber (TRCF). The sensor is fabricated by fusion splicing a segment of TRCF between two pieces of single-mode fiber (SMF), forming the SMF-TRCF-SMF sandwich structure. Since the TRCF can support the propagation of a few guided modes, the fundamental mode interferes with high-order modes in the sensing part to produce a periodic interference spectrum. Bending causes the effective refractive index of the mode to change, which shifts the interference spectrum. The bending measurement is achieved by monitoring the wavelength variation of interference dips. The proposed sensors can realize curvature measurements up to 100 m -1 , with a bending sensitivity of -225.9 pm/m -1 . It is believed that the proposed MZI sensor may have potential applications in robot hand gesture recognition and control.
